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Dropdown accessibility improvements #475

Open
desig9stein opened this issue Aug 16, 2022 · 2 comments
Open

Dropdown accessibility improvements #475

desig9stein opened this issue Aug 16, 2022 · 2 comments
Assignees
Labels
a11y When the issue or PR is related to accessibility bug Something isn't working drop-down 🆕 status: new The issue is new and will be reviewed when somebody picks it up.

Comments

@desig9stein
Copy link
Contributor

Description

The screen reader does not read any of the items inside the dropdown.

@desig9stein desig9stein added bug Something isn't working 🆕 status: new The issue is new and will be reviewed when somebody picks it up. labels Aug 16, 2022
@desig9stein desig9stein added a11y When the issue or PR is related to accessibility drop-down labels Aug 16, 2022
@simeonoff simeonoff assigned desig9stein and unassigned simeonoff Sep 30, 2024
@desig9stein
Copy link
Contributor Author

Still reproducible: When you open the dropdown, it reads all the item values, including the headers if available. However, it doesn't tell you which item is selected or which one you are currently on.

@simeonoff
Copy link
Collaborator

@desig9stein Seems this issue cannot be fixed until there is some mechanism that allows us to reflect the aria-related attributes from within the shadow DOM into the light DOM.

There are several ongoing proposals for how this can be resolved, but I believe the latest one can be found here.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
a11y When the issue or PR is related to accessibility bug Something isn't working drop-down 🆕 status: new The issue is new and will be reviewed when somebody picks it up.
Projects
None yet
Development

No branches or pull requests

2 participants